This report is part of a general study of labor relations in urban transit financed by the Urban Mass Transportation Administration (UMTA). The general study will be submitted to UMTA as four separate reports. The purpose of the study is to analyze labor relation trends in municipal bus systems, to identify the determinants of wage rates and labor costs, and to examine the impact of governmental assistance programs on collective negotiations. This report analyzes the legal framework of collective bargaining in local transit within the private-public transition period of transit systems.
